The Last Guardian of the Prophecy

The sun dipped below the horizon, casting long shadows over the ancient forest of Eldoria. The air was thick with the scent of pine and the distant hum of an unseen world. In the heart of this forest, a young woman named Aria sat cross-legged on a moss-covered rock, her eyes closed, her fingers tracing the intricate symbols etched into the stone.

The prophecy, The Yui's Prophecy, spoke of a time when the realm would be threatened by darkness, and only a chosen guardian could prevent it. Aria had been that guardian since childhood, raised by the ancient order of the Correctors, who had trained her in the ways of magic and strategy. Now, as the prophecies began to unfold, she knew her time had come.

"Guardian Aria," a voice echoed through the trees, "the time has come for you to fulfill your destiny."

Aria opened her eyes to see an elderly figure stepping out from the shadows. It was Master Elara, the head of the Correctors. "You must journey to the Heart of the Prophecy, where the truth lies hidden," Master Elara continued. "But be warned, the path is fraught with danger, and those who seek to thwart your mission will stop at nothing."

Aria nodded, her resolve unwavering. "I will not fail, Master Elara. I will protect the prophecy and the realm."

With that, Aria set off into the forest, her path illuminated by the soft glow of fireflies. She traveled through dense woodlands, crossed treacherous rivers, and climbed towering mountains, each step drawing her closer to the Heart of the Prophecy.

On her journey, Aria encountered a diverse array of characters. There was the roguish thief, Kael, who had stolen a piece of the prophecy from a rival faction and was willing to help Aria in exchange for a share of the rewards. There was the wise old hermit, Thalor, who had hidden the final piece of the prophecy in a place only the pure of heart could find. And there was the mysterious sorceress, Lyra, who seemed to know more about the prophecy than she let on.

As Aria delved deeper into the prophecy, she uncovered a web of deceit and betrayal. The Correctors were not as pure as she had been led to believe, and their true intentions were shrouded in mystery. She learned that the prophecy was not just a warning of impending doom, but also a testament to the power of choice and the resilience of the human spirit.

The climax of Aria's journey came when she discovered the Heart of the Prophecy, a massive stone structure at the center of a sacred grove. Inside, she found the final piece of the prophecy, a scroll that revealed the true nature of the impending darkness. The darkness was not a force of nature, but a manifestation of the realm's own fears and insecurities.

With the scroll in hand, Aria returned to the Correctors' temple, where she confronted Master Elara and the other leaders. "The prophecy is not a curse," Aria declared. "It is a mirror reflecting our own shortcomings. We must face our fears and come together as a people to overcome this darkness."

Master Elara, taken aback by Aria's revelation, realized the truth of her words. "You are right, Aria. We have been blinded by our own fears. We must change our ways and work together to protect our realm."

As Aria and the Correctors worked to spread the truth and unite the people, the darkness began to recede. The realm was saved, not by magic or might, but by the collective will of its people.

In the end, Aria's journey was not just about fulfilling a prophecy, but about discovering her own strength and the power of unity. She returned to the ancient forest, not as a guardian, but as a leader, ready to face whatever challenges lay ahead.

The Last Guardian of the Prophecy was a tale of courage, redemption, and the enduring power of hope. It was a story that would be told for generations, inspiring people to look beyond their fears and unite in the face of adversity.
